Mindfulness for Health

Add mindfulness practice to your daily life to tap into a number of brain benefits

Bad traffic, work snafus, family problems — there are many stressful things that happen that we can’t control. What we can control is how we react to and experience these events. It’s called mindfulness, and studies show it’s a very effective way to calm the unhealthy cycle of stress. Watch the video to learn about the STOP technique, an easy mindfulness method that can enhance focus, memory and clear thinking, as well as dial down the stress that’s bad for your brain.
